Output 93ed564d83ded90296575ebde1a61b384e9882ad17b45f85f08d21d4680d50bb:0

value
21006552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 460de33e397bea7cfed80a0fcd287185f068c954 OP_EQUAL
address
385RruPGV4MqrWxUT7irvJu6p6ht82zxnX
transaction
93ed564d83ded90296575ebde1a61b384e9882ad17b45f85f08d21d4680d50bb
spent
true